Ex-minister Nuruzzaman Ahmed placed on 5-day remand

Following the court order, he was taken back to Kotwali police station

Former social welfare minister and Lalmonirhat Awami League leader Nuruzzaman Ahmed has been placed on a five-day remand.

Judge Debi Rani Roy of the Metropolitan Magistrate's Court 3 of Rangpur passed the order on Friday.

Earlier, at around 9:15am, the former minister was brought to court under tight security.

Following the court order, he was taken back to Kotwali police station.

Nuruzzaman is the key accused in a case filed over the killing of one SM Munna during the Anti-Discrimination Student Movement on August 4.

After the court's decision, defence counsel Advocate Iftha Akhtar, speaking to the media, claimed Nuruzzaman was not in Rangpur during the incident and was wrongfully accused.
